Specialty Doctor (ST equivalent) in inpatient General Adult Psychiatry - Evans ward, Clare ward, Virginia Woolf Ward - three posts available

The jobs will involve providing input for: a male inpatient ward in Evans ward and Clare ward or a female inpatient ward in Virginia Woolf Ward.

All the teams will have a full complement of MDT staff including a Consultant Psychiatrist, one middle grade Doctor (ST level) and two CT/Trust grade doctors per ward (including these roles).

Main duties of the job

Management of the day-to-day caseload of the ward

  • Assessing new patients and management of all patients admitted to the ward. The applicant must be able to conduct in-depth informed clinical interviews, to be able to do mental state assessments, risk assessments (with risk management plan - supported by team Consultant and MDT colleagues), general physical examination and request relevant investigations like ECG, Bloods and formulate appropriate treatment plans with the clinical team and support their implementation.
  • Attending daily team handover and other clinical meetings and twice weekly ward rounds

Job responsibilities
  • Carrying out risk assessments and formulating appropriate risk management plans
  • Formulating care plans and carrying out treatment interventions as appropriate
  • Safe prescribing and recording of drug information
  • Physical health monitoring of patients including carrying out physical examination and investigations as appropriate
  • Post holder will be required to do necessary documentation in the patient's electronic notes and liaise with the ward multidisciplinary team and the Consultant as well as other services including carers and relatives, to optimise care
  • You may be required to make referrals to other services and complete discharge and other relevant documentation in a timely manner
  • Liaising with GPs and various other professionals/teams within and outside SLAM including with social services, DVLA and the Voluntary sector
